We do not need more highways - we already have the underused 407 running a similar route to the proposed new highway.
To reduce congestion, we need more investment in alternatives to personal vehicle infrastructure.
Use this funding instead to increase go transit frequency on routes around milton and vaughn.
If the provincial government is intent on micromanaging individual cities infrastructure, create alternatives to car infrastructure, instead of removing bike lanes - give transit right of way, especially downtown toronto streetcars, and people will be incentivized not to drive cars.
